COOL v. HUBBARD

No. 43263.

199 N.W.2d 510 (1972)

Richard F. COOL et al., Respondents, v. Stanley S. HUBBARD et al., Appellants.

Supreme Court of Minnesota.

June 23, 1972.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Leonard, Street & Deinard and Charles A. Mays and Lowell J. Noteboom, Minneapolis, for appellants.

Eastwood & Goyer and Philip H. Eastwood, Stillwater, for respondents.

Heard before KNUTSON, C. J., and OTIS, TODD, and GUNN, JJ.


OPINION

WILLIAM D. GUNN, Justice.*

Defendants, Stanley S. Hubbard and Karen E. Hubbard, appeal from a judgment entered following trial of an action by plaintiffs, Richard F. Cool and Helen M. Cool, for specific performance of a contract or damages and a counterclaim for reformation of the same contract. The trial court granted plaintiffs' request for specific performance but allowed them no damages and denied defendants' request...
